Artist's
Description
|
First
of all, I am extremely excited about
the idea of this project. Since I
am Native American, I would really
like to be a part of the creation
of one of the buffalo. My buffalo
sketch is just that, a sketch. I want
to emphasize how important detail
is to me. My work is known for its
detail. My design is to use acrylics
and oils to create a beautiful, detailed
painting of a Native American rug
draping across the back of the buffalo.
The swirls coming from the headdress
of the Native American intertwine
with the buffalo and join the Indian
and buffalo as one. The Native American
figure's head is held up showing pride
in who he is and what he represents.

The
shield is the Oklahoma trademark standing
for pride of Oklahoma and the Native
American people it represents. The
buffalo will be done in high detail
from the hair, eyes, hoofs and etc.
Deep bold colors will be used for
the rug, soft blue for the headdress,
and a variety of earth tones for the
rest. Hours upon hours will be spent
on detail within the rug, Native American
figure, shield and buffalo itself
